|
|
|
|
|
by jacquesm
214 days ago
|
|
These are excellent practices. Such data is a liability, not an asset and if you dispose of it as soon as you reasonably can that's good. If this is a communications service consider saving a hash of the ID and refusing new sign ups with that same ID because if the data gets deleted then someone could re-sign up with someone else's old account. But if you keep a copy of the hash around you can check if an account has ever existed and refuse registration if that's the case. |
|
It's important that "delete all my information" also deletes everything after the user logs in for the first time.
Also, I'm not sure that Apple would allow it. They insist that deletion remove all traces of the user. As far as I know, there's no legal mandate to retain anything, and the nature of our demographic, means that folks could be hurt badly by leaks.
So we retain as little information as possible -even if that makes it more difficult for us to adminster, and destroy everything, when we delete.